  • Open Source
    Back In Time is an open-source software project, allowing anyone to view, modify, and contribute to its source code, which promotes transparency and community-driven development.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    The application features a straightforward and intuitive interface that makes it accessible for users of different skill levels to configure and manage their backups efficiently.
  • Incremental Backups
    Back In Time supports incremental backups, meaning that only changes made since the last backup are saved, which saves time and storage space.
  • Scheduling
    The software offers detailed scheduling options, allowing users to automate their backup processes at specified intervals, which enhances convenience and ensures data is regularly backed up.
  • Configurable
    Back In Time allows for extensive configuration options to suit individual needs, such as setting up multiple backup profiles, filtering files and directories, and defining backup interval details.

Possible disadvantages

  • Limited Platform Support
    Back In Time is primarily designed for Linux, which might limit its usability for users on other operating systems like Windows or macOS.
  • Dependency on rsync
    The tool relies on rsync for data transfer, which may not be available or may require additional configuration on some systems, potentially posing a barrier for users less familiar with command-line tools.
  • Lack of Cloud Integration
    While it supports local and external drive backups, Back In Time does not offer direct integration with popular cloud storage services, which may be a drawback for those looking for cloud-based backup solutions.
  • Potential Performance Overhead
    Depending on system resources and the size of data being backed up, Back In Time could introduce performance overhead during backup processes, which might be noticeable for users with limited hardware capabilities.
  • Steep Learning Curve for Advanced Features
    While basic use is straightforward, some of the more advanced features and configurations may have a steep learning curve for users not familiar with backup solutions, requiring a deeper understanding to implement effectively.

  • Back In Time is generally considered a good option for users who need a simple and effective backup solution on Linux. It is well-suited for both beginners and experienced users who want a no-fuss application to secure their files.

Why this product is good

  • Back In Time is a simple, easy-to-use backup application for Linux systems. It provides a straightforward graphical user interface, and its use of rsync and hard links makes it efficient in terms of storage. The tool allows for automated backups at regular intervals, making it a reliable option for safeguarding data.
